finalshell文件拖动不了
时间: 2025-05-03 16:41:14 浏览: 114
### FinalShell 文件拖动功能失效解决方案
FinalShell 是一款强大的远程管理工具,支持多种协议并提供便捷的功能操作。如果遇到文件拖动功能失效的情况,可能是由于配置错误、权限不足或者环境设置不当引起的。
以下是可能的原因以及相应的解决方法:
#### 1. **检查 FinalShell 的版本**
确保当前使用的 FinalShell 版本是最新的稳定版[^3]。旧版本可能存在未修复的 bug 或兼容性问题,建议前往官方下载页面获取最新版本并重新安装。
#### 2. **确认目标服务器上的权限**
文件拖放功能依赖于客户端与服务端之间的交互。如果目标目录缺乏写入权限,则可能导致拖拽失败。可以通过以下命令验证目标路径是否有足够的权限:
```bash
ls -ld /path/to/directory
```
上述命令可以显示指定目录的具体权限信息。如果没有 `w` 权限,请尝试通过 `chmod` 修改权限或切换到具有适当权限的账户登录[^4]。
#### 3. **启用 SFTP 协议的支持**
FinalShell 使用 SFTP 进行文件传输。如果 SFTP 功能被禁用或存在连接异常,可能会导致拖拽功能无法正常工作。可以在 SSH 配置中手动开启 SFTP 支持,并测试其连通性。
编辑 `/etc/ssh/sshd_config` 文件,确保以下选项已正确配置:
```bash
Subsystem sftp /usr/lib/openssh/sftp-server
```
保存更改后重启 SSH 服务以应用新设置:
```bash
sudo systemctl restart sshd
```
#### 4. **调整 FinalShell 设置**
进入 FinalShell 的高级设置界面,检查是否启用了文件拖拽的相关选项。具体步骤如下:
- 打开菜单栏中的「设置」-> 「SFTP 和 FTP」。
- 勾选允许文件上传和下载的操作项。
- 如果网络延迟较高,可增加超时时间来改善稳定性[^5]。
#### 5. **排查本地操作系统的影响**
有时主机系统的剪贴板或其他组件干扰了 FinalShell 的正常使用体验。对于 Windows 用户来说,尝试关闭其他占用资源的应用程序后再试一次;而对于 Linux 平台下的用户则需注意桌面环境是否存在特殊限制条件[^6]。
---
### 总结
当面对 FinalShell 中文件拖动功能失效这一情况时,应依次按照以上几个方面逐一排查原因所在——从基础层面如软件升级至深入细节像参数微调均不可忽视。只有全面考虑各种可能性才能有效定位问题根源进而妥善处理。
阅读全文
相关推荐
















